And angle measure 60* less than the measure of its complimentary angle what is the measure of each angle

Answer:

the angles are 75 and 15

Explanation:

Our task is to find the other angle, given that the two angles are complementary.

Complementary angles add up to 90°.

Therefore,


\angle1+\angle2=90

One of the angles measures 60° more than the other one. Therefore, the equation is:


x+x+60=90

Combine like terms:


2x+60=90


2x=30


x=15

The other angle:


15+60=75
